  • the present invention relates to the field of packaging and packaging, and in particular to the field of packaging fragile objects having a generally cylindrical shape.
  • the invention particularly relates to the field of "ampoules", which are packaging kits for the transport of ampoules and pharmaceutical vials. These kits are sometimes used in extreme conditions, especially for emergency medicine. These kits are, in the prior art, constituted by rigid boxes filled with a shock absorbing material. These conditions are not entirely satisfactory. They do not protect the bulbs sufficiently against impact. Furthermore, they are not well suited to emergency medicine, requiring, in addition to impact resistance, great ergonomics and maximum ease of access.
  • the object of the present invention is to provide packaging overcoming these drawbacks, by optimally protecting the fragile objects it contains, while offering great ease of access and optimal viewing of the content.
  • the invention relates in its most general sense to packaging for fragile objects of generally cylindrical shape, formed by a profile made of an elastically deformable material characterized in that said profile forming two panels each having a periodic alternation of concave transverse cells semi-cylindrical opening on a portion less than 180 °, and transverse cells overall convex protuberances, the transverse cells of the first panel being offset by about half a step with respect to the transverse cells of the second panel so that the convex protuberant beads of a panel are partially accommodated in the concave cells of the complementary panel .
  • the profile is made of a polyethylene foam whose density is between 20 and 30 kg / m 3 .
  • the convex transverse cells have a general semi-cylindrical shape.
  • At least part of the convex transverse cells have a transverse concave channel, of semi-cylindrical shape opening on a portion less than 180 °, the section of said concave channel being smaller than the section of transverse concave cells.
  • the profile comprises concave transverse cells of a first section and concave transverse cells of at least a second section.
  • the profile is completely covered with a polyurethane elastomer 1 to 2 millimeters thick.
  • the packaging according to the invention further comprises an envelope having an interior volume corresponding to the volume of the profile in the position in which the two panels are folded over one another.
  • the envelope is formed by a folded plastic sheet to surround the folded profile.
  • the envelope is formed by a rigid box.
  • the envelope is formed by a box comprising a filling material having a cavity whose internal volume corresponds to the external volume of the profile.
  • the box has two parts joined by a hinge, at least one of the parts comprising a filling material having a plurality of cavities for housing materials.
  • the invention also relates to a method for manufacturing a packaging for fragile objects according to claim 1 characterized in that a block of elastically deformable material is cut with a heated wire, by moving the wire along the section of the profile.
  • the profile is plasticized using a polyurethane elastomer 1 to 2 millimeters thick.
  • the block of elastically deformable material is formed by juxtaposition of a plurality of longitudinal sheets of an elastically deformable material.

  • Figures 1 and 2 show perspective views of a profile respectively in the unfolded position and in the folded position.
  • the profile is formed by a block of polyethylene foam having closed cells of approximately 3 ⁇ m of medium section, with a density of approximately 24 kg / m 3 .
  • the block is formed by juxtaposition of several longitudinal sheets (1 to 5) each having a thickness of about 20 mm. These sheets are glued against each other to form a rectangular block which is then cut with a heated wire to present the profile shown in Figure 1.
  • the profile has two complementary panels (6, 7), connected by a hinge (8) .
  • the first panel has alternating concave cells (9 to 17) of semi-cylindrical shape, and convex beads (19 to 27).
  • the concave cells (9 to 17) close at an angle between 250 and 320 degrees, in order to pinch cylindrical objects housed inside the cell.
  • the object can be forced in due to the elasticity of the material. It is held in place by the walls of the cell, insofar as its section and neighboring, and greater than the section of the cell.
  • the protrusions (19 to 28) have a semi-cylindrical shape so as to connect two consecutive cells.
  • the spacing of the concave cells (9 to 17) is constant.
  • the second panel (6) presents three different types of concave cells, distinguished by their section.
  • This panel also has protruding bulges (29 to 37) spaced with the same pitch as that of the first panel, with however a longitudinal offset of half a pitch, so that at a bulge of one of the panels corresponds to a concave cell of the other panel, as can be seen in Figure 2.
  • the second panel has a first category of transverse cells (40) whose section is the same as that of the cells (9 to 17) of the first panel (7).
  • transverse cells 41 to 43
  • small cells 44 to 48
  • cells of small section 50 to 53.
  • the latter are formed on the crest of certain beads.
  • the cell section varies for example between 8 and 23 mm.
  • beads of one of the panels come to bear on the flared part of the cells of the complementary panels, and thus contribute to the correct wedging of fragile objects housed in the transverse cells.
  • the hinge (8) is formed by a transverse strip (54) a few millimeters thick, delimited on either side by grooves (55, 56).
  • the transverse strip may have a “V” section so as to give the profile a good hold.
  • Figures 3 and 4 show an example of packaging in which the profile is introduced into a flexible envelope formed by a plastic sheet (60) provided with a foldable flap (61).
  • the envelope surrounds the profile longitudinally to keep it in the closed position.
  • the opening of the folding flap presenting a closing system of the “velcro” type (trade name) makes it possible to unfold the profile.
  • the elements arranged in the cells are partially visible, and can be easily removed due to the flexibility of the material constituting the profile.
  • FIG. 5 represents a top view of a particular form of the invention. It consists of a box made up of two parts (100, 101) articulated by a hinge (102). In the closed position, the two parts (100, 101) are folded over one another to form a rigid box that is easy to handle and transport.

  • the kit includes two cylindrical foam blocks, the base of which is a rectangle with rounded edges. In each of these blocks, identical at the start, we cut different volumes or compartments intended to receive all of the content.
  • the blocks are covered with a polyurethane film, for example a product known under the commercial name of POLYBRON 685. It can be sprayed, cast or produced by dipping the foam blocks. This coating facilitates cleaning.

  • the closed position the two blocks are joined base against base.
  • the kit is then similar to a suitcase by its external appearance.
  • In the open position the two blocks are juxtaposed and connected by a hinge lined in PVC fabric.
  • a central double zipper allows the opening and closing of the whole.
  • the outer surface can be covered with a PVC canvas cover.
  • the cover is detachable, it has 4 handles: two central handles on the front and one on each side base.
  • the fragile elements are insulated in specific compartments and protected by a thickness of 2 to 3 centimeters of cellular foam.
  • the arrangement of the elements is carried out to distribute the weight.
  • the solute bottles (113) are placed in cavities provided in the center of the kit, and the heavy materials are distributed to balance the load.

Abstract

The invention concerns a packaging for brittle objects globally cylindrical in shape, formed by a shaped section made of deformable material, having a section forming two panels (6, 7) each exhibiting a periodic alternation of semi-cylindrical concave transverse cells (9-17, 19-27) opening on a lower portion at 180°, and protruding globally convex transverse cells, the transverse cells of the first panel being offset by about half a pitch relative to the transverse cells of the second panel such that the protruding transverse ribs of one panel are urged to be partially housed in the cells of the matching panel.
